Hi, thanks for sharing! We've seen a bit of feedback on 3 ships in Artifact Brawl, so leaping in here to clarify a few points. Long story short - this isn't actually due to low population currently, rather some attempted guardrails to try to support new player experience, that we can potentially adjust. TL:DR, context and longer explanation of what's happening below.

Great to hear feedback on how this feels for you all, particularly brand new players!

TL:DR -

  • At the moment, there is not a low population compared to the last few months - players online and queues are the best they've been in some time, happily :)
  • 3 ships as you're describing is partially by design to try to help new players out, and something the team can potentially change a bit (longer explanation below for details)
  • We'll be looking at the data today (when folks are back in USA time) and seeing what makes sense to change

Past and Present Context -

-Few Ships as a match modifier was created in the past when player count / population was indeed lower. The idea here was to help games of Artifact Brawl start more quickly with 3 ships, or less ships than a full 5.

Right now, we're seeing a pretty healthy amount of people jumping into and playing Wildgate daily since January 1st/Epic free. Many more on a concurrent and daily basis than what you can see on Steam tracking sites, as Epic players won't be visible on those.

How Artifact Brawl matches/ships in lobby work for 'new' players currently -

We have some guardrails in matchmaking around Artifact Brawl to try to help new players right now.

Here's the rough workings:

  • Brand 'new' players (you are a new account) are restricted to 3 ship Artifact Brawl games while they are below a certain 'skill/MMR' rating
    • Idea here was to try to relieve pressure of a 5 ship game on brand new crews. From previous feedback in the old Artifact Hunt/Brawl only world, we'd see players were struggling to get used to Wildgate before being thrown into ship vs ship PVP.
  • After 10 games, 'new' players should then see 4 ship matches
  • Once new players reach a certain 'skill/MMR' rating after that (not a huge leap), they'll see 5 ship matches

Totally open to feedback on how this feels for you all, particularly brand new players. How are initially 3 ship games feeling for you, compared to any 4 or 5 ship games you've played? Have you played any larger games yet/gone through the above?

There's room to adjust - remember that matchmaking always is a bit of give and take - so, for the 'give' of 5 player lobbies, there will be a 'take' slightly of something else (queue time or other match making factors)!

The balance between boarding strength and other things have been ongoing topics and sources of debate since even closed testing and alphas. In higher skilled matches, or skill diff'd situations, you can see FPS skilled players able to make boarding *pretty*oppressive.

Generally, boarding an enemy ship right now is best to do with a goal. Relieve pressure so you can repair/escape, get offensive and steal their valuable hardpoint/weapon, or similar. The broad direction of tuning has been to make boarding a tool rather than *the* tool. People will happily share their opinions on whether they feel that's good for them or not ;)

Reactor Overload at one point was very damaging to ships - now, it's another plate spinning in the air. You don't want to ignore it long term as with other sources of damage and pressure - but, it's not a win condition on its own.

Ship battles - again, might be a newer crew vs newer crew thing (which is probably a better scenario to start - we don't want new crews being thrown in too often against experienced crews right away, gives you time to learn the game!). In the right engagements/scenarios, ship battles can be short and deadly. Destroying/disabling enemy cannons or hardpoints, jumping on the enemy helm and dropping their shields/turning off their engines...there are many ways of ship fighting and boarding that can very rapidly swing fights.

The Outlaw was built in response to, amongst other things, the community wanting smaller crews to have some ways to play. A Treasure Hunting, Explore The Reach, jump in and loot some treasure/have a good time type option. In a fight against another player ship with 4 people, most people would expect it to come off worst (we think?)

We've seen two player, very skilled Outlaw crews give some 4 player ships a run for their money, but even in Artifact Brawl, 2 player Outlaws are very much like blockade runners. You might get an artifact victory here and there in that mode, but in any sustained firefight, it's going to be very tough.

To clarify, the game is free to keep until January 8th on Epic. That means that anyone who adds it to their Epic library before the end, has a copy of Wildgate to play for free even after that date and after the promotion ends!

Epic players (which we're seeing a good amount of joining and trying the game) are not visible on SteamDB or other websites. Appreciate people will be looking at Steam sites for player count, but they are not a reflection of player count at this time.
